A playful, animated new campaign by BBDO Dublin officially launched this week on behalf of retailer Lidl Ireland. Titled “Beefgrudgery”, it sets out to highlight the outstanding quality and value of Lidl beef in a standout and memorable way.

A teaser campaign released through social media on Friday, 4th June, introduced the cast of characters, in the form of Bread, Cheese, Strawberry and Turnip that are brought to life through a ‘clay-mation’ technique with some very well-known and loved Irish voices playing the parts to hilarious effect.

This funny and quirky new work was developed by creative duo Kevin McKay and Eoin Tierney, and was produced by Piranha Bar. The story centres around interviews with food ‘characters’ in the Lidl store to get their take on all the attention Lidl beef is deservedly getting.

Renowned comedian Tony Cantwell plays “Bread”; Norma Sheahan of ‘Bridget and Eamon’ and ‘Dead Still’ fame is the “disgruntled Cheese”; Shauna Davitt plays the “Blogger Strawberry”; and the “Kerry Turnip” is played to perfection by Jon Kenny of the famed ‘D’Unbelievables’.

The four-week campaign runs until 7th July, across TV, Radio, Print, Interactive, Social Media, VOD and P&I, with OOH live on 14th June.
